Output 34fde39c17da80d2c53dcfcc76f5ca280a747a0e84aa115e69b56f28f0d8f8e5:0

value
214160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c7241d8c4e6b0368d8eaf02fa0d4674adc9341 OP_EQUAL
address
3ES6Qmmdcn9dMw9BMRaujobZE2hj437ZHd
transaction
34fde39c17da80d2c53dcfcc76f5ca280a747a0e84aa115e69b56f28f0d8f8e5
spent
true